Chicago Bears Fantasy Football Analysis – Week 1

Week 1 – vs GB – L 23-31

QB: Cutler was Jekyll and Hyde again.  Looks so good at times and then makes the worst decisions.  Still a good start with the right match up.

RB: Forte a monster game and looks as good as ever.  Hasn’t lost anything yet and might finish in the top 5 RBs if his line can give him as much space as they did in this one.

WR: Jeffery solid and didn’t look too affected by injury.  Definitely on the cusp of being an elite WR.  Royal did almost nothing.  Wilson might be the real #2 on this team.  Good enough to do it if he can be consistent.

TE: Bennett a good game and no reason to think it won’t continue.  As solid a fantasy TE as most others in the league not named Gronk.

OL: Looked pretty good against weak run D.  Had occasional trouble with blitz but pass protection was fine.  Probably going to have some ugly games against better lines.

Def: Still terrible against the run.  Wasn’t able to stop WRs.  Tough match up but nothing about this D scares me.  Gave up good games to RB and 3 different WRs.
